The Allure of Gold: Design and Craftsmanship
The gold bezel immediately sets the Breitling Chronomat Evolution apart. Unlike the sparkle of diamonds, the gold bezel offers a more understated, yet equally luxurious, aesthetic. The warm, rich tone of the gold complements the watch's overall design, creating a sophisticated and timeless appeal. The precise milling and finishing of the bezel are hallmarks of Breitling's commitment to quality. The smooth, polished surface reflects light beautifully, enhancing the overall visual impact. The contrasting gold against the dial, whether it be black, silver, or another color option, creates a striking visual balance, ensuring the watch remains legible and aesthetically pleasing.
The case itself, typically constructed from stainless steel, provides a sturdy and durable foundation for the watch. The combination of steel and gold creates a balanced aesthetic, avoiding an overly ostentatious look. The size of the case, often around 44mm, makes it suitable for a range of wrist sizes, while maintaining a commanding presence. The crown and pushers, typically also made from stainless steel, are ergonomically designed for ease of use, even with gloved hands, a testament to Breitling's focus on functionality.
Technical Prowess: The Heart of the Chronomat
The Breitling Chronomat Evolution houses a self-winding mechanical movement, typically a COSC-certified chronometer. This certification guarantees a high level of precision and accuracy, confirming its ability to meet stringent standards for timekeeping. The automatic movement eliminates the need for manual winding, offering convenience and reliability. The intricate mechanics visible through the exhibition caseback (depending on the specific model) allow the wearer to appreciate the craftsmanship and precision of the movement.
The chronograph function, a key feature of the Chronomat line, allows for precise time measurement. The pushers provide a smooth and responsive feel, enabling accurate start, stop, and reset functions. The subdials, carefully positioned on the dial, display elapsed time with clarity. The date window, often integrated seamlessly into the dial, adds a practical element to the timepiece's functionality.
